PHILANA MARIE BOLES. Ballantine/One World, $13.95 paper (320p) ISBN 0-345-44712-3
"Men are a dime a dozen and I have five dollars," Shawni Kaye Baldwin brags to Ernie, her gay hairstylist and closest confidant, at the beginning of Boles's cliche-riddled debut. Newly engaged and pushing 30, she behaves exactly like the spoiled, empty-headed caricature she's so afraid of becoming ("I wonder if I look like a hoochie"), addicted to surface flash and material goods.
